      My point on our polisher is this, the hardest step and the step that takes the most time is the step where you remove the swirls out of the paint, this means the step where you remove a little paint.

      DA Polishers like our and the Porter Cable Unit, (which Meguiar's introduced to the detailing world back in the early 1990's before everyone and their brother put up a website and added these tools to their store), are popular because they are safe and easy to use as compared to a rotary buffer.

      Their safety feature is also the reason it takes longer to remove swirls and this is because they have a clutch which stops the pad from spinning when too much pressure is applied or the pad is not held flat on a flat surface.

      The specific point is this, more power is better and means doing the swirl removal step faster. You can use both tools to remove the swirls out of paint but our G110 will tend to enable you to do this faster because of the little bit of extra power.

      It's all about keeping the pad rotating while doing the cleaning step as that's when paint is removed best. Just some tidbits of information based upon years of experience using these tools and teaching others how to use them.
